Warning Signs You Need Plumbing Failure Water Damage Restoration
Sometimes, plumbing issues don’t result in a dramatic flood. Small leaks or slow drips can cause significant damage over time without being immediately obvious. Catching these signs early can save you a lot of money and prevent the need for more extensive restoration work. Being aware of what to look for is the first step in protecting your property. Ignoring subtle signs can lead to costly structural damage.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ent damp, musty smell, especially in bathrooms, kitchens, or basements,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This odor is often caused by mold or mildew growing in damp areas, even if you can’t see the water itself. Addressing the source of the moisture is key to eliminating unpleasant smells.
Visible Water Stains or Discoloration
Look for dark or discolored spots on ceilings, walls, or around plumbing fixtures. These stains mean water has been seeping into the material, weakening it and potentially creating a breeding ground for mold. These are clear signs of active water intrusion.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per
Moisture trapped behind paint or wallpaper can cause it to lose its adhesion, leading to peeling, bubbling, or cracking. This is a visual cue that the underlying material is saturated and compromised. This indicates material degradation.
Warped or Damaged Flooring
If you notice your hardwood floors buckling, warping, or developing gaps, it’s likely due to moisture exposure from a leak below or within the floor structure. Vinyl or tile can also lift or become damaged. This shows subfloor compromise.
High Humidity Levels Indoors
If your home feels unusually damp, or if condensation is forming on windows and pipes, it could indicate a hidden leak or a failure in your plumbing system that’s introducing excess moisture into the air. This creates an unhealthy environment.
Sounds of Dripping or Running Water
If you hear sounds of dripping, hissing, or running water when no fixtures are in use, it’s a direct warning that there’s an active leak somewhere in your plumbing system. Don’t ignore these sounds; they signal urgent attention needed.
Plumbing Failure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small toilet overflow onto tile floor | Yes, with caution | Yes, if water spreads | Tile is less porous, but grout can absorb water. |
| Leaking pipe under sink with minor visible water | Yes, for temporary fix | Yes, for full drying | Hidden moisture can spread quickly behind cabinets. |
| Burst pipe causing significant flooding in multiple rooms | No | Yes, immediately | Professional equipment is needed to remove large volumes of water quickly. |
| Water stain on ceiling from suspected upstairs leak | No | Yes, immediately | This often indicates structural damage and potential mold growth. |
| Damp smell in basement near washing machine hookups | No | Yes, immediately | Slow leaks can cause extensive hidden mold and rot. |
| Dishwasher hose burst, flooding kitchen | Yes, to shut off water | Yes, for drying | Kitchen flooring and subflooring are particularly susceptible to damage. |

Common Questions About Plumbing Failure Water Damage Restoration
What should I do immediately after a pipe bursts?
Your first step is to shut off the main water supply to your home to prevent further flooding. Then, if it’s safe to do so, move any valuable items away from the affected area. How long does plumbing failure water damage restoration take?
The timeline varies significantly based on the extent of the water damage. Minor leaks might be resolved in 2-3 days, while severe flooding could take a week or more for complete drying and restoration. We use advanced drying techniques to expedite the process, but thoroughness is key to preventing future issues.
Is plumbing failure water damage covered by homeowner’s insurance?
Typically, standard homeowner’s insurance policies cover sudden and accidental water damage from plumbing failures, like a burst pipe. However, they usually don’t cover damage from slow leaks or lack of maintenance. It’s always best to check your specific policy and contact your insurance adjuster. How can I prevent plumbing failures in my home?
Regular maintenance is crucial. Have your plumbing system inspected periodically, especially older pipes. Insulate pipes in unheated areas to prevent freezing, and be aware of any unusual noises or drips. Promptly addressing minor issues can prevent major failures and avoid costly repairs.
